Speaking of saying the ideal points, do not inform the dealership what month-to-month settlement you're looking for. If you desire the most effective deal, start negotiations by asking the dealership what the out-the-door rate is.


Mazda Finance Near MeMazda Dealer Near Me
FYI: The sticker cost isn't the overall cost of the car it's just the manufacturer's suggested market price (MSRP). Keep in mind those taxes and charges we stated you'll have to pay when acquiring an automobile? Those are included (on top of the MSRP) in what's called the out-the-door price. Why work out based on the out-the-door price? Dealers can expand financing repayment terms to strike your target month-to-month settlement while not reducing the out-the-door price, and you'll wind up paying more rate of interest over time.


Both you and the dealer are qualified to a reasonable offer yet you'll likely wind up paying a little bit more than you desire and the dealership will likely get a little less than they desire - mazda cx-50 dealer near me. Always start negotiations by asking what the out-the-door rate is and go from there. If the dealership isn't going reduced sufficient, you may have the ability to work out some specific products to get closer to your desired cost
